> What would be the recommended way to model variables that are allocated
> to different address spaces?
Can you describe the architecture a bit?
> I found DW_OPT_xderef for dereferencing address-space qualified pointers
> but the resulting memory location description wouldn?t have an
> address-space qualifier.
DW_OPT_xderef translates from an architecturally defined memory
reference including an address space into a linear address space
(generic type). DWARF doesn't support computations on address-space
qualified addresses, although using a typed stack, this could be an
extension.
